Weather in November

November, the last month of the spring in Gumlu, is another warm month, with an average temperature ranging between min 23.1°C (73.6°F) and max 28°C (82.4°F).

Temperature

Gumlu marks the onset of November with an average high-temperature of a still moderately hot 28°C (82.4°F), subtly divergent from October's 26.8°C (80.2°F). A consistent nighttime average temperature of 23.1°C (73.6°F) is maintained in Gumlu during November.

Heat index

The heat index for November is calculated to be a tropical 31°C (87.8°F). If one continues to be active during enduring exposure, it could result in fatigue and heat cramps.
When assessing, remember that heat index measurements are for light winds and shaded spots. The heat index might be elevated by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ees due to direct sun exposure.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'real feel', is calculated by taking the relative humidity value for a specific location and factoring it into the air temperature reading. Elements such as metabolic variations, pregnancy, and physical exertion can shape one's weather perception. Exposure to direct sun rays can influence the heat you feel, pushing the heat index up by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ly important for children. Young individuals usually face more risks than adults due to their lower sweat production. Their large skin surface area relative to their tiny bodies and high heat production from their activities adds to their risk.

Humidity

In Gumlu, the average relative humidity in November is 73%.

Rainfall

In Gumlu, during November, the rain falls for 9.2 days and regularly aggregates up to 24mm (0.94") of precipitation. Throughout the year, in Gumlu, there are 137.2 rainfall days, and 628mm (24.72")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

In November, the average length of the day is 13h and 3min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 5:27 am and sunset at 6:18 pm. On the last day of November, sunrise is at 5:20 am and sunset at 6:34 pm AEST.

Sunshine

In November, the average sunshine is 10.7h.

UV index

January, February,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index in Gumlu.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for average individuals.
Note: The daily high UV index of 7 during November translates into the following recommendations:
Eschew overexposure. Those with light skin may suffer burns in fewer than 20 minutes. Stay in the shade and avoid direct Sun exposure from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., a period when UV radiation is particularly strong, noting that parasols or canopies may not offer total sun protection. Employ a wide-brim hat for potent defense against up to 50% of UV rays.
